Vice Chancellor’s International Student Scholarship at BNU

The Vice Chancellor’s International Student Scholarship at the Buckinghamshire New University is a scheme established to support students in the university to cushion the effect of financial difficulties during their period of study. Buckinghamshire New University is a public university in Buckinghamshire, England, with campuses in High Wycombe, Great Missenden, Aylesbury and Uxbridge.

The scholarship is divided into two categories which include those for new students and those for continuing students.

Offer for New Students

If you are a self-funded International Student paying oversea fees, you may qualify for a scholarship of £1,500 on your first year of study in Buckinghamshire New University.

Eligibility Criteria for New Students

Applicants must hold an offer from Buckinghamshire New University for a full-time taught degree programme, starting in September 2023, February 2024 or April 2024.

Note that you do not need to complete an application form to be considered for this scholarship.

Offer for Continuing Students

Self-funded International Students paying overseas fees you may qualify for a further scholarship of £1,500 on each of their subsequent year/s of study with us. This scholarship is available for students continuing on to Level 5 (Year 2) and Level 6 (Year 3), (as well as Level 4 (Year 1) for Foundation level students).

Eligibility Criteria and Conditions for Continuing Students

  • One off fee reduction of £1,500 available to all applicants paying overseas fees on their first year of study
  • Applicant must be self-funded
  • Programme of study must be at least one year in duration
  • The tuition fee charged must be at least £15,000
  • This scholarship cannot be used in conjunction with another scholarship or bursary offered by Buckinghamshire New University.
  • The scholarship is only available as a one-off fee reduction of £1,500 for each year of study
  • Continuation scholarship is subject to satisfactory attendance and successful progression on the course, from the previous level of study.
